Subject: [PATCH v3] hciconfig: Remove putkey command
Date: Wed,  5 Dec 2012 12:43:54 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1354707834-30972-1-git-send-email-frederic.danis@linux.intel.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1354705606.1815.6.camel@aeonflux>

With new storage architecture legacy storage "linkkeys"
file doesn't exist anymore.
---
 tools/hciconfig.8 |    5 -----
 tools/hciconfig.c |   64 -----------------------------------------------------
 2 files changed, 69 deletions(-)
